首页 > TAG信息列表 > django-1-7

python-字典更新序列元素#0的长度为15; 2个为必填项

我正在将python / django应用程序从1.6.5升级到1.7.我在解决以下错误时遇到麻烦:字典更新序列元素#0的长度为15; 2个为必填项 这是回溯输出: Request Method: GET Request URL: http://127.0.0.1:8000/dashboard/ Django Version: 1.7 Python Version: 2.7.5 Installed Applications

python-Django 1.7-具有自定义应用程序标签的模型发现和应用程序配置

我目前正在使用Django == 1.7.1.我有一些具有相同模块名称的可重复使用的应用程序.这也使模型的应用程序标签相同.这实际上是矛盾的.您不能在设置文件的INSTALLED_APPS中的不同库中使用两个具有相同名称的模块. 我通过为模块添加一个AppConfig来解决此问题,并更改了它们的标签(app_

如何JSON序列化Django模型的__dict__?

我想在Django中序列化单个模型的值.因为我想使用get(),values()不可用.但是,我在on Google Groups读到您可以使用__dict__访问这些值. from django.http import HttpResponse, Http404 import json from customer.models import Customer def single(request, id): try:

python – django.db.utils.IntegrityError:(1062,“重复条目”为密钥’slug’”)

我正在尝试关注tangowithdjango书,必须添加一个slug来更新类别表.但是,我在尝试迁移数据库后遇到错误. http://www.tangowithdjango.com/book17/chapters/models_templates.html#creating-a-details-page 我没有为slug提供一个默认值,所以Django要求我提供一个,并按照书中指示我输

python – django URL中的”NoReverseMatch

NoReverseMatch at / login / Reverse for '' with arguments '()' and keyword arguments '{}' not found. 0 pattern(s) tried: [] 我找到了我认为urls.py中的错误 urlpatterns = patterns('', url(r'^/?$', 'u

python – Django – 与模型无关的自定义管理页面

我正在使用Django 1.7和Mezzanine.我想在管理员中有一些页面,工作人员可以使用按钮和其他控制元素调用某些操作(管理命令等). 我还想避免创建新模型,或手动创建模板并添加链接(如果可能). 如何实现这一目标最常见/最简洁的方法是什么?解决方法:实际上它更简单.就在urls.py之前的urlp

python3 manage.py迁移异常

我是django 1.7和python3的新手.我正在使用OSX.正如我在线关注django 1.7文档, 我试过了 python3 manage.py migrate 结果 Operations to perform: Apply all migrations: auth, contenttypes, sessions, admin Running migrations: No migrations to apply. Traceback (most re

python – 不使用db查询预取对象?

我从我的数据库中获取具有预取关系的多个对象: datei_logs = DateiLog.objects.filter(user=request.user) .order_by("-pk") .prefetch_related('transfer_logs') transfer_logs指的是: class TransferLog(models.

python – Django 1.7:传递未保存的实例会引发“不可避免的”异常

我目前正在迁移到Django 1.7.我有一些信号传递未保存的模型实例,现在抛出TypeError:没有主键值的模型实例是不可用的. 我想知道Django pre_save信号如何在实例周围传递?我正在查看文档,甚至找到了在1.7(https://github.com/django/django/commit/6af05e7a0f0e4604d6a67899acaa99d73ec